One of the best Hong Kong pools for a dip with a view is Island Shangri-La’s pool in the heart of the city. The resort’s secluded setting and array of lounge chairs with views of some of the city’s most iconic buildings makes it feel like a relaxing island escape.

The indoor pool here has floor-to-ceiling windows overlooking the towers of the city skyline, so you can enjoy the breathtaking scenery while swimming. This pool is the perfect place to relax and recharge, or you can take a break in the jacuzzi or sauna.

If you’re staying at the hotel, the best part is that all guests can use the pool for free! But non-hotel guests can still visit during weekdays, for four hours, using a pass which costs HKD 600 for adults and HKD 300 for children under 12. This Wong Chuk Hang swimming pool complex is a hidden gem that’s been taking the local community by storm. The vast complex includes two main pools, a training pool, a diving pool and a toddler pool, so there’s something for everyone, regardless of age or ability. The main pool is surrounded by a row of palm trees and has a waterfall, making it a stunning sight to behold, while the kid’s pools are filled with slides, sprinklers and other fun water play toys to keep the little ones happy.

The glistening blue tiles of Hyatt Centric’s infinity pool gleam under the sun, so make sure to bring your camera or phone along to snap some photos of the beautiful scene. The pool is a great spot to stretch out for a swim, or you can just enjoy sweeping vistas of Victoria Harbour at sunrise or sunset. Afterwards, head to the lounge area and order a cocktail from the bar or sit down for a tranquil afternoon of reading and relaxation.
